Gennaro Contaldo (OSI) was born on January 20, 1949. He is a famous Italian chef. Many people know him because he worked with the British chef Jamie Oliver. He also starred in a TV show called Two Greedy Italians with another Italian chef, Antonio Carluccio.

Gennaro's Early Life
Gennaro grew up in a small village called Minori in Italy. This village is on the beautiful Amalfi Coast. He learned to love food from a young age. He would go hunting with his dad and grandpa. He also helped his mom collect fresh herbs for cooking. Gennaro started working in local restaurants when he was only eight years old.
Gennaro's Cooking Career
In 1969, Gennaro left Italy and moved to England. He started working in a hospital kitchen there. Later, in 1974, he got married and had three children. He later had two more children with his current partner. For a short time, he had a business selling old Italian items. But he soon went back to cooking.
Gennaro loved cooking in England because he could find lots of wild game and mushrooms. These foods were very important in the cooking style from his home region, the Amalfi Coast. He often talks about how much he enjoys finding wild foods, especially different kinds of mushrooms.
Working in London Restaurants
Gennaro worked at popular restaurants in London. One of these was Antonio Carluccio's Neal Street Restaurant in Covent Garden. He left Neal Street in 1998.
In 1999, Gennaro opened his own restaurant called Passione. It was on Charlotte Street in London. Passione was even named 'Best Italian Restaurant' in 2005! However, the restaurant closed in 2009. This happened because of tough economic times.
Gennaro's Cookbooks
Gennaro has written many cookbooks. His first book, Passione, came out in 2003. It was all about the cooking style from his home, the Amalfi Coast. This book won an award for 'Best Italian Cuisine Book'. He has written many more cookbooks since then, sharing his delicious Italian recipes. His most recent book, "Panetteria: Gennaro's Italian Bakery," was published in 2016.
Working with Jamie Oliver
Gennaro is well-known for his friendship and work with chef Jamie Oliver. They first met in the 1990s at Neal Street Restaurant. They have stayed close friends and work together often. Gennaro has appeared on many of Jamie Oliver's TV shows, like The Naked Chef. He even helped Jamie Oliver as a sous-chef on a cooking show called Iron Chef America. Gennaro also helped create the menus for Jamie Oliver's restaurants in the UK, called Jamie's Italian. He is a business partner in these restaurants.
Two Greedy Italians TV Show
In 2011, Gennaro toured different parts of Italy with Antonio Carluccio. They filmed a four-part TV series for the BBC called "The Two Greedy Italians". They explored Italian food and culture together. They made a second series in 2012 called "The Two Greedy Italians: Still Hungry".
TV Records and Online Presence
Gennaro has appeared on many other TV cooking shows. On the BBC show Saturday Kitchen, he set a record for making a three-egg omelette in just 16.36 seconds! In 2014, he also earned a Guinness World Record. He made the most ravioli in two minutes.
Gennaro is also an ambassador for Citalia, a company that offers Italian holidays.
Since 2010, Gennaro has had his own YouTube channel. He regularly uploads videos there. He also often appears on Jamie Oliver's YouTube channel. By July 2022, Gennaro's channel had over 36 million views and 600,000 subscribers!

Books Written by Gennaro
- Passione (2003)
- Gennaro's Italian Year (2006)
- Gennaro's Italian Home Cooking (2008)
- Gennaro's Easy Italian (2010)
- Two Greedy Italians (2011)
- Two Greedy Italians Eat Italy (2012)
- Panetteria: Gennaro's Italian Bakery (2016)
- Gennaro's Pasta Perfecto! (2019)
- Gennaro's Limoni: Vibrant Italian Recipes Celebrating the Lemon (2021)
